Jefferson Capital Announces Launch of Secondary Public Offering and Concurrent Share Repurchase

MINNEAPOLIS, Jan. 05, 2026 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Jefferson Capital, Inc. (Nasdaq: JCAP) (“Jefferson Capital”), a leading analytically driven purchaser and manager of charged-off, insolvency and active consumer accounts, today announced that certain of its existing stockholders intend to offer for sale in an underwritten secondary offering 10,000,000 shares of Jefferson Capital’s common stock. In addition, the underwriters of the offering will have a 30-day option to purchase from the selling stockholders up to 1,500,000 additional shares of common stock at the public offering price, less underwriting discounts and commissions. The selling stockholders will receive all of the net proceeds from this offering.

As part of the secondary offering, Jefferson Capital intends to concurrently purchase from the underwriters 3,000,000 shares of common stock at a per-share purchase price equal to the price payable by the underwriters to the selling stockholders in the proposed offering. The repurchased shares of common stock will be retired and will no longer be outstanding after the proposed offering. The completion of the share repurchase is contingent on the satisfaction of customary closing conditions and conditioned upon the completion of the proposed offering.

Jefferies and Keefe, Bruyette & Woods, A Stifel Company, are acting as joint-lead book-running managers for the proposed offering. About Jefferson Capital, Inc.

Founded in 2002, Jefferson Capital is an analytically driven purchaser and manager of charged-off, insolvency and active consumer accounts with operations in the United States, Canada, the United Kingdom and Latin America. It purchases and services both secured and unsecured assets, and its growing client base includes Fortune 500 creditors, banks, fintech origination platforms, telecommunications providers, credit card issuers and auto finance companies. Jefferson Capital is headquartered in Minneapolis, Minnesota with additional offices and operations located in Sartell, Minnesota, Denver, Colorado and San Antonio, Texas (United States); Basingstoke, England, London, England and Paisley, Scotland (United Kingdom); London, Ontario and Toronto, Ontario (Canada); as well as Bogota (Colombia).
